Last weekend, the Vicarious team had the wonderful opportunity to attend and sponsor the fourth edition of Kaleidoscope ,

Kaleidoscope is not just an extremely well curated display of all things colourfully Porsche, but great detail is also put into selecting each years venue! That is very evident with this year being hosted at the Parkwood National Historic Site in Oshawa!

Founder Ryan, was extremely excited to announce this years venue almost as much as the wonderful line up of cars, and seeing it in person first hand we can definitely understand why, between the vintage aesthetic and sprawling gardens across the property, you can almost forget you’re in Ontario, Canada!

Then the final dynamic of the day: The Rain.

What would usually postpone a car show in most cases only made Kaleidoscope that much better, soaking the ground, leaving droplets of water all over various colours of paint and creating a whole new dynamic of contrast. It shows that these cars are meant to be driven and properly used. They don’t melt!

We look forward to attending many more years of Kaleidoscope and watching it grow it numbers and in colour!
